Space Targets Classification and Recognition Based on Affine Invariant Moments

  An affine transformation model is established for ground-based photoelectric imaging and detecting systems.This model shows that affine transform consists of five basic transformations,which are translation,scale,slant and rotation transformations.Six affine invariant moments are given with geometrical moments.Furthermore.affine invariant moment vectors of training data are calculated for four-class simulated space target images.For different viewpoint angle target images,the affine invariant moments are calculated.Simulation experiments are performed for space targets classification and recognition through their eigenvectots comparing.Simulated results show that the method of target images classification recognition based on affine invariant moments is effective.
